LST387

Ship Designation: 
LST-387
Date Lost: 
Tuesday, June 22, 1943
Torpedoed near Algiers
On June 22, 1943, LST-387 was steaming in Convoy Elastic, enroute from Arzew Algeria, To Bizerte, Tunisia. LST-387 and LST-333 were both damaged in an sequence of explosions. About twenty minutes after the explosion occurred, the LCT-244 and LCT-19 came close in and stood by to render assistance. The Commanding Officers of these craft had observed torpedo tracks heading for the LST-387 and the LST-333. Significant efforts on the parts of other convoy members were made towards rescue and recovery operations. The ship was later repaired.
